随着科技的不断进步,企业内部应用的开发方式也在经历着深刻的变革。低代码开发作为一种新兴的技术趋势,正在成为推动企业数字化转型的关键力量。本文将深入探讨低代码开发的原理、优势以及其在企业内部应用中的实践案例,旨在帮助读者了解这一革命性的变革,并探讨其对企业未来发展的影响。
低代码开发概述
定义
低代码开发(Low-Code Development)是一种可视化的软件开发方法,通过使用图形界面和配置工具,简化了传统编程流程,让非专业人员也能参与到应用开发中。低代码平台通常提供丰富的组件库、拖放界面和配置选项,大大降低了开发门槛。
工作原理
低代码开发平台的工作原理通常包括以下几个步骤:
- 设计阶段:用户通过图形界面设计应用流程、数据模型和用户界面。
- 配置阶段:用户配置应用的行为和逻辑,如条件语句、循环等。
- 部署阶段:平台自动生成代码,并部署到服务器或云环境中。
低代码开发的优势
降低开发门槛
低代码开发的核心优势之一是降低开发门槛。它使得技术小白也能参与到应用开发中,提高了开发效率。
加速开发周期
通过可视化的开发方式和预制的组件库,低代码开发可以显著缩短应用开发周期。
提高企业灵活性
低代码开发平台通常具有较好的扩展性和可定制性,能够满足企业不断变化的需求。
降低开发成本
由于开发门槛低,企业可以减少对专业开发人员的需求,从而降低开发成本。
低代码开发在企业内部应用的实践案例
案例一:某企业管理系统
某企业采用低代码开发平台开发了一套内部管理系统,实现了员工信息管理、考勤管理、项目管理等功能。该项目从设计到部署仅用了两个月时间,极大地提高了企业的管理效率。
案例二:某电商企业客户关系管理系统
某电商企业利用低代码开发平台构建了一个客户关系管理系统,实现了客户信息管理、订单处理、售后服务等功能。该系统具有高度的可定制性,能够满足企业不断变化的需求。
低代码开发的未来展望
随着技术的不断发展,低代码开发平台将更加智能化、自动化,进一步降低开发门槛,提高开发效率。未来,低代码开发将成为企业数字化转型的重要工具,助力企业实现高效、灵活的业务创新。
总结
低代码开发作为一种新兴的软件开发方法,正在改变企业内部应用的开发模式。它不仅降低了开发门槛,提高了开发效率,还能帮助企业实现数字化转型。随着技术的不断发展,低代码开发有望成为未来工作方式的重要趋势。